The first of our financial statements examples is the cash flow statement. The cash flow statement shows the changes in a company’s cash position during a fiscal period. The cash flow statement uses thenet incomefigure from the income statement and adjusts it for non-cash expenses. This is ...
The conditions prerequisite to the interpretation of financial statements are an understanding (1) of the information required by the particular user, (2) of the terminology, and (3) of the rules or conventions employed byaccountantsin their preparation of financial statements. Examples of Financial Statements The external financial statements issued by U.S. corporations should include all of the following: Income statement Statement of comprehensive income Balance sheet or statement of financial position Statement of cash flows Statement of stockholders’ equity Related Questions...
